KATHMANDU: Gold prices declined on Monday, according to the Federation of Nepal Gold and Silver Dealers’ Association.
The federation said the price of gold fell by Rs 2,600 per tola, bringing the new rate to Rs 291,400 per tola. On the Sunday, gold had been traded at Rs 294,000 per tola.
Silver prices also decreased on the same day. The price of silver dropped by Rs 50 per tola and is currently being traded at Rs 4,780 per tola.
